Arrive

Staff Software Engineer, Data

Arrive

full-time

Posted on:

Location Type: Hybrid

Location: LondonUnited Kingdom

Visit company website

Explore more

AI Apply
Apply

Job Level

About the role

  • Architect and Implement: Own the technical roadmap for our Spark-based data processes to ensure our Airflow pipelines are performant, cost-effective, and scalable.
  • Drive Engineering Excellence: Define standards for efficient, testable and reusable Python code across the organisation that ensure our services remain reliable, robust, and easy for other engineers to extend.
  • Bridge Strategy and Execution: Partner with Data Scientists to translate modeling requirements into high-performance production services.
  • Modernize Infrastructure: Evolve our infrastructure-as-code (AWS) and CI/CD pipelines to keep up with cutting-edge approaches.
  • Advance Data Capabilities: Lead the hands-on development of platform enhancements, such as establishing feature stores for machine learning and building automated data monitoring systems to ensure data integrity and model reproducibility.
  • Scale AI Practices: Lead the adoption of AI throughout the software development lifecycle, evolving our internal coding practices while ensuring systems remain reliable and maintainable.

Requirements

  • Extensive history of building and scaling data-intensive applications in production, with a track record of leading technical initiatives from conception to deployment.
  • Expert-level Python and its data ecosystem (Numpy, Pandas), including designing frameworks for data tasks.
  • Deep understanding of distributed data processing engines like Apache Spark.
  • A strong command of Linux, containers (Docker), and infrastructure as code for cloud deployments (AWS preferred).
  • A passion for elevating engineering standards through pair programming and detailed code reviews to help other engineers grow their technical depth.
Benefits
  • Flexible working - hybrid home and office-based opportunities.
  • Paid Leave if you participate in an event for Charity.
  • 25 Days holiday entitlement.
  • An enhanced Workplace Pension Scheme - 5% by Arrive, 3% by you.
  • Private Medical Health Insurance.
  • Fantastic wellbeing programmes, including On-site Sports massages, Reiki and Head massages every week.
  • Discounted gym membership.
  • Access to Blue Call, a mental health support platform.
  • Enhanced Maternity and Paternity offering.
Applicant Tracking System Keywords

Tip: use these terms in your resume and cover letter to boost ATS matches.

Hard Skills & Tools
PythonApache SparkNumpyPandasLinuxDockerinfrastructure as codeCI/CDdata monitoring systemsfeature stores
Soft Skills
engineering excellencecollaborationtechnical leadershipcode reviewspair programmingcommunicationproblem-solvingmentorshipscalability focusadaptability